Transaction 1296401034c02c53c47019914b3fea8000eda5e5dbe6e5eb2881a7d9fdc52051

1 Input
2 Outputs
  • 1296401034c02c53c47019914b3fea8000eda5e5dbe6e5eb2881a7d9fdc52051:0
  • value  5640773
    address  3QPFBg2dLvcDvkpuC8sWo3qzxU6od2hu6x
  • 1296401034c02c53c47019914b3fea8000eda5e5dbe6e5eb2881a7d9fdc52051:1
  • value  1477524038
    address  bc1qnlc6f8es5067aynfdycpj65r99nfrs4g742ypf